ToggleIGNOU MSc Climate Change Programme: Complete Overview
| Particular | Details |
|---|---|
| University Name | Indira Gandhi National Open University |
| Programme Name | Master of Science (Climate Change) |
| Programme Code | MSCCC |
| Programme Type | Degree |
| Mode of Learning | Open Distance Learning |
| School | School of Inter-Disciplinary and Trans-Disciplinary Studies |
| Duration | 2 Years |
| Medium | English |
| Specialization | Climate Change |
| Eligibility | Graduation in any discipline |
| Fee | Rs. 8,000 per year plus registration fee and development fee as applicable |
| Total Credits | 80 Credits |
| First Year Credits | 40 Credits |
| Exit Option | Post Graduate Diploma in Climate Change after successful completion of first-year courses |
| Programme Coordinators | Dr. V. Venkatramanan and Prof. Shachi Shah |
| Best For | Graduates, working professionals, educators, policymakers, sustainability learners, and environmental enthusiasts |

Duration and Credit Structure
The climate change course in IGNOU is a 2-year programme with 80 credits. The course structure is divided into first year and second year. Each year carries 40 credits.
| Programme Structure | Details |
|---|---|
| Total Duration | 2 Years |
| Total Credits | 80 Credits |
| First Year Credits | 40 Credits |
| Second Year Credits | 40 Credits |
| Exit Option | PG Diploma in Climate Change after successful completion of first-year courses |
| PG Diploma Credit Requirement | 40 Credits |
The official programme page also mentions that learners who exit after successfully completing the first-year courses of 40 credits may opt to receive the Post Graduate Diploma in Climate Change.
This is useful for students who may not be able to continue the full two-year programme but still want a recognised exit qualification after completing the first year successfully.
First Year Course Structure
The first year gives learners a strong base in climate science, climate impacts, mitigation, adaptation, assessment tools, sustainable development, society, water, energy, agriculture, and disaster risk reduction.
| Course Code | Course Title | Type | Credits |
|---|---|---|---|
| MEV-021 | Introduction to Climate Change | Theory | 4 |
| MEV-022 | Impacts of Climate Change | Theory | 4 |
| MEV-023 | Mitigation and Adaptation to Climate Change | Theory | 4 |
| MEV-024 | Climate Change Assessment Tools | Theory | 4 |
| MSD-019 | Global Strategies to Sustainable Development | Theory | 4 |
| MEV-025 | Climate Change and Society | Theory | 4 |
| MEV-026 | Climate Change and Water | Theory | 4 |
| MEV-027 | Climate Change and Energy | Theory | 4 |
| MEV-028 | Climate Change and Agriculture | Theory | 4 |
| MEV-029 | Climate Change and Disaster Risk Reduction | Theory | 4 |
These subjects help students understand climate change from different angles. For example, climate change and water helps learners understand water stress and resource planning. Climate change and agriculture connects climate risks with farming and food security. Climate change and disaster risk reduction helps students understand extreme weather events and resilience planning.
Second Year Course Structure
The second year focuses on environmental legislation, research methodology, waste management, circular economy, governance, lab work, project work, and optional courses.
| Course Code | Course Title | Type | Credits |
|---|---|---|---|
| MEV-017 | Environmental Legislations | Theory | 4 |
| MEV-019 | Research Methodology for Environmental Science | Theory | 4 |
| MEV-030 | Climate Change, Waste Management and Circular Economy | Theory | 4 |
| MEV-031 | Climate Change and Governance | Theory | 4 |
| MEVL-032 | Climate Change Lab Course | Lab | 8 |
| MEVP-033 | Project Work | Project | 8 |
The second year is important because it helps learners move from basic understanding to applied learning. Lab work and project work allow students to connect theory with practical climate-related problems. The governance and legislation courses help students understand how climate action is connected with laws, policies, institutions, and decision-making.
Optional Courses in Second Year
Students must choose any two optional courses from the official list.
| Course Code | Optional Course Title | Type | Credits |
|---|---|---|---|
| MEVE-019 | Environmental Issues | Theory | 4 |
| MEVE-014 | Biodiversity Conservation and Management | Theory | 4 |
| MEV-014 | Sustainable Natural Resource Management | Theory | 4 |
| MIO-001 | Introduction to Smart Regions: Smart Cities and Smart Villages | Theory | 4 |
| MCS-224 | Artificial Intelligence and Machine Learning | Theory | 4 |
These optional courses make the programme more flexible. A learner interested in conservation can choose biodiversity. A learner interested in technology and future planning can choose smart regions or artificial intelligence and machine learning. A learner interested in resource management can choose sustainable natural resource management.
